How Bill Greenwood's Slugging Pct Compares to Similar Players

Bill Greenwood posted a career Slugging Pct of .287, near the league average of .310 — a profile that tracked closely with league norms. His best Slugging Pct season came in 1882, posting .333. The lowest point came in 1888 at .227, well below the league average of .331 that year. The Slugging Pct trended upward through the final seasons. The figure moved from .227 in 1888 to .312 in 1889 and .288 in 1890. The upward arc continued through his final campaign. Some season-to-season variance runs through the career line, but the career average tracked near league norms across 6 seasons.
